Tsodilo hosts two-day softball tournament
13 Nov 2019
Tsodilo Junior Secondary School in Maun will host a two- day softball development tournament in preparation for next year’s competitions, including Botswana Integrated Sports Association (BISA) competitions.
The tournament, scheduled for 16-17 November at Tsodilo school playgrounds, will attract eight junior secondary schools, including the host.
The schools to participate are Oodima, Shanganani, Moeti, Maitlamo, Shakawe, Popagano, Sedibelo and Tsodilo.
In an interview, the organiser of the tournament, Tsodilo’s Basiame Molathiwa revealed that the tournament was also aimed at bringing pupils together to develop their skills.
He stated that most schools were not doing well in softball and hoped the tournament would give coaches an opportunity to assess their teams’ performance and skills and see where they could improve.
The event, he said, would also help the host to raise funds to buy more equipment and kits for the school teams.
He said softball was one of the fastest growing sporting codes in the school, as most pupils had shown interest in taking part.
Molathiwa said Tsodilo had been doing well in softball as it had been crowned the champion in national tournaments for the past 10 years.
He said pupils wanted to be associated with the winning sporting code and that resulted in the formation of many teams with no equipment and kits.
He said the school recently participated in a tournament in Mochudi where they emerged champions and walked away with medals and kits.
BISA is an association which continues to lead in developing talent at school level.
The association hosts competitions in all sporting codes where coaches select a team that would represent the country at the Confederation of School Sport Associations of Southern Africa (COSSASA). ENDS
